Morocco Modernizes Dam Monitoring Systems as Water Policy Demonstrates Strategic Foresight
Morocco’s Equipment Ministry launched comprehensive upgrades to the Maghreb Dam Application (MORDAM) used for daily dam reservoir monitoring, aiming to enhance data reliability, strengthen anticipation, and support more reactive hydraulic governance. The Water Research and Planning Directorate pilots this digital transformation initiative modernizing hydrological data collection, consolidation, and analysis nationwide.
